Our #SeedlingGiveaway event on Siksika Nation was a huge success with 34 amazing volunteers! We handed out over 1,100 Seedling Bags, each containing 5 trees - that's more than 5,500 seedlings now growing around the homes of Nation residents! 🌲🌳 The following day, Chief Old Sun School picked up four remaining seedling boxes with 360 Saskatoons and 260 Showy Mountain Ash, which students planted at the school. 🌿 A big thank you to our funding partners and volunteers for supporting the Project Forest Siksika Nation Community Shelterbelt Program! 💚 Learn more about the project here: https://lnkd.in/g5F7845U #Community #Volunteers #SiksikaNation #OneForestataTime Siksika Communications, Pembina Pipeline Corporation, Canadian Land Reclamation Association (CLRA/ACRSD) National, Nutrien, ATB Financial, Enverus, Alberta Ecotrust Foundation
